Sesfontein Guesthouse occupies the centre of Sesfontein village in Kunene Region, 110 kilometres north of Palmwag. The property comprises ten standard rooms, each furnished with one double bed; an extra single bed can be added. All rooms are en-suite with air-conditioning and mosquito nets. A swimming pool, secure parking, and complimentary wireless internet are available on site. The restaurant prepares meals using local ingredients including bananas, pumpkins, tomatoes, and carrots grown in the region; the kitchen bakes its own bread daily.

Full-day drives depart for the Hoanib River to track desert-adapted elephants on foot and by vehicle; sightings are never guaranteed. Morning excursions visit Himba villages where residents demonstrate daily tasks and explain traditional life. Sundowner drives climb to lookout points above the village with drinks and snacks at sunset. Sleep-out packages place dome-style tents with stretchers and bedrolls in the Hoanib riverbed or among rocks for a night under open sky. Rhino-tracking excursions on foot with a guide run as multi-day packages combining nights at the guesthouse with a riverbed camp. You can hear roosters before dawn. Ongongo Waterfall Campsite at Warmquelle lies 25 kilometres south, also operated by the guesthouse.
